Cécile Penot Dietrich is a professional Chef graduated from CSCA professional Chef’s program. She created French in the Kitchen, a cooking class business in Arlington, MA, in 2015. She is passionate about sharing her decades long love for cooking with kids and adults by teaching a variety of classes including after school, corporate events, thematic classes.Originally a French attorney by trade, changed my career path after her relocation to the Boston area, 15 years ago.
